#d4b04f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d4b04f is composed of 83.1% red, 69%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 17% magenta, 62.7%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 43.8 degrees, a saturation of 60.7% and a lightness of 57.1%. #d4b04f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ff9e with #a96100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

● #d4b04f color description : Moderate orange.
#d4b04f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d4b04f has RGB values of R:212, G:176, B:79 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.17, Y:0.63,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13938767.
